首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

简单的Salesforce包装器身份验证Python

Salesforce包装器身份验证Python是一个用于与Salesforce平台进行交互的Python库。它提供了一组API和工具,用于简化与Salesforce的集成和开发过程。

Salesforce是一家领先的云计算公司,提供了一系列的云服务,包括客户关系管理(CRM)、销售、服务、市场营销等解决方案。Salesforce的平台是基于云计算架构构建的,可以帮助企业管理客户关系、提高销售效率和客户满意度。

Salesforce包装器身份验证Python的主要功能是提供身份验证机制,以便开发人员可以使用Python与Salesforce进行安全的通信。它使用Salesforce提供的OAuth 2.0协议进行身份验证,并提供了一些便捷的方法和类,用于生成和管理访问令牌、刷新令牌和身份验证会话。

该包装器还提供了一些其他功能,如查询和检索Salesforce对象、创建和更新记录、执行SOQL查询、处理错误和异常等。它使开发人员能够轻松地在Python应用程序中集成Salesforce功能,并与Salesforce平台进行数据交互。

Salesforce包装器身份验证Python的优势包括:

  1. 简化集成:它提供了一组简单易用的API和工具,使开发人员能够快速集成和使用Salesforce功能。
  2. 安全性:通过使用OAuth 2.0协议进行身份验证,确保了与Salesforce平台的安全通信。
  3. 灵活性:它提供了丰富的功能和选项,使开发人员能够根据自己的需求定制和扩展集成。

Salesforce包装器身份验证Python适用于各种场景,包括但不限于:

  1. 开发Salesforce集成应用程序:开发人员可以使用该包装器在Python应用程序中集成Salesforce功能,如数据同步、自定义业务逻辑等。
  2. 数据分析和报告:通过使用该包装器,可以轻松地从Salesforce平台中提取数据,并进行分析和报告。
  3. 自动化任务:可以使用该包装器编写Python脚本,自动执行与Salesforce相关的任务,如数据导入、记录更新等。

腾讯云提供了一系列与Salesforce集成相关的产品和服务,可以帮助用户更好地使用和管理Salesforce平台。其中,推荐的产品是腾讯云API网关(API Gateway)。API网关是一种托管的API管理服务,可以帮助用户轻松构建、发布和管理API,并提供身份验证、访问控制、流量控制等功能。通过使用API网关,用户可以更好地管理与Salesforce的集成,并确保安全和可靠的通信。

腾讯云API网关产品介绍链接地址:https://cloud.tencent.com/product/apigateway

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Swift 中属性包装

让我们看一下属性包装是如何工作,并探讨一些可以在实践中使用它们情况示例。...属性属性 属性包装也可以有自己属性,并且支持进一步定制,甚至可以将依赖项注入到包装类型中。...然而,通过在通用属性包装中实现这种逻辑,我们可以使其易于重用——因为这样做可以让我们简单地将包装附加到任何希望由UserDefaults支持属性。...其中包含所有具有默认值属性默认参数——这意味着我们可以通过简单地指定每个属性要由哪个UserDefaults键支持来初始化它实例: struct SettingsViewModel { @...即使在诸如SwiftUI这样声明性框架之外,属性包装也有大量潜在用例,其中许多不需要我们对整体代码进行任何大更改——因为属性包装大部分都是完全透明地运行。

2.7K30
  • C++11互斥包装

    为何要引入互斥包装?...++11中引入互斥体包装,互斥体包装为互斥提供了便利RAII风格机制,本质上就是在包装构造函数中加锁,在析构函数中解锁,将加锁和解锁操作与对象生存期深度绑定,防止使用mutex加锁(lock...C++11提供了lock_guard和unique_lock两种互斥包装。 2. lock_guard 类 lock_guard 是互斥体包装,为在作用域块期间占有互斥提供便利RAII风格机制。...lock_guard使用方法非常简单,通过构造函数上锁,在销毁时候解锁,对于一些简单场景使用也非常方便高效,但对于一些作用域比较大场景,可能会影响效率,例如如下场景: int g_i = 0...因此对于普通简单场景,lock_guard也是不错选择。

    16420

    13种降低包装成本简单方法

    但是,无论采用何种降低包装成本方法,我们电商运营对包装材料需求是一直都存在,这意味着当我们需要除了降低包装材料采购成本,还要提高包装材料使用效率。...但节省包装费用最有效方法根本不涉及如何降低包装材料采购费用。 1-提高仓储员工包装效率 所有负责包装员工都必须了解包装流程和接受包装培训。...当然,这样做可以为我们省钱,但是当扫帚坏了,我们就既没有塑料托盘包装把手也没有扫帚了。从传送带到起重机械再到简单胶带分配器,包装处理流程一切工具都需要处于完美的工作状态。...在没有问题情况下关注包装流程和包装物流使用,这意味着我们可以清楚地看到整个流程工作效率以及是否存在降低包装成本方法。...但我们包装费用不仅仅是纸板箱,我们要降低整体包装费用,还要看包装耗时、包装方式、退货政策和仓库分区等多个影响包装成本内容。

    2.9K40

    探讨 SwiftUI 中几个关键属性包装

    在这篇文章中,我们将探讨几个在 SwiftUI 开发中经常使用且至关重要属性包装。本文旨在提供对这些属性包装主要功能和使用注意事项概述,而非详尽使用指南。...本文应几位朋友之邀而写,旨在帮助已经熟悉通用编程但对 SwiftUI 相对陌生开发者,快速理解这些属性包装核心作用和适用场景。...它常用于简单 UI 组件状态管理,如开关状态、文本输入等。 如果数据不需要复杂跨视图共享,使用 @State 可以简化状态管理。...属性包装本质上是一个结构体。使用 @ 前缀时,它用于包装其他数据;而不带 @ 时,表示其自身类型。...在 Observation 框架背景下,@State 和 @Environment 成为了最主要属性包装。无论是值类型还是 @Observable 实例,都可以通过这两种包装引入视图。

    32410

    Python 图形化界面基础篇:使用包装( Pack )布局元素

    Python 图形化界面基础篇:使用包装( Pack )布局元素 引言 在 Python 图形化界面的基础篇课程中,我们将深入研究 Tkinter 库布局管理之一:包装( Pack )布局。...Pack 布局是一种简单而有效方式,用于在 Tkinter 应用程序中排列和布局 GUI 元素。它允许你沿着一个方向将元素堆叠在一起,这对于创建垂直或水平排列元素非常有用。...Tkinter 是 Python 标准库中 GUI 工具包,用于创建图形用户界面( GUI )应用程序。 Tkinter 提供了多种布局管理, Pack 布局是其中之一。...然后,在你 Python 脚本中导入 Tkinter 模块,以便使用 Tkinter 库功能。...Pack 布局是一种简单而强大布局管理,适用于许多 GUI 应用程序中元素排列。通过创建一个容器并使用 pack() 方法,你可以轻松地控制元素排列方式,并使用选项来自定义元素布局。

    93440

    Python实现简单Web服务

    Python实现简单Web服务 一、课程介绍 2. 内容简介 互联网在过去20年里已经大大地改变了我们生活方式,影响着社会。但是反观互联网,它基础-web核心原理并没有改变多少。...本课程将通过使用 Python 语言实现一个 Web 服务,探索 HTTP 协议和 Web 服务基本原理,同时学习 Python 如何实现 Web 服务请求、响应、错误处理及CGI协议,最后会根据项目需求使用...课程知识点 本课程项目完成过程中,我们将学习: HTTP 协议基本原理 简单 Web 服务框架 Python 语言网络开发 Web 服务请求,响应及错误处理实现 CGI 协议 Python 实现...超文本传输协议(HTTP)描述了一种程序之间交换数据方法,它非常简单易用,在一个socket连接上,客户端首先发送请求说明它需要什么,然后服务发送响应,并在响应中包含客户端数据。...##四、实验步骤 ###1.你好, web 现在就来写我们第一个web服务吧, 基本概念非常简单: 等待某个人连接我们服务并向我们发送一个HTTP请求 解析该请求 了解该请求希望请求内容 服务根据请求抓取需要数据

    11600

    简单聊聊Python解释(一)

    Python解释,从运行过程上来说就是在模拟一个CPU处理,只要理解了这一点,python中鼎鼎大名全局解释锁和多进程也就能够理解了。...虽说如此,但是我们还是可以基于多台服务,用python实现一个简单分布式架构和多进程处理框架,不过这又是另一话题了。)所以,在只要理解了CPU处理机制也就理解了python解释。...解释激活相当简单,只要在屏幕上输入python,就可以了,如下图。 ?...整个执行过程简单来讲,python会先对文件中源代码进行编译生成一条条字节码,最后再由虚拟机按照顺序一条条执行,就完成了整个过程。如下图。 ?...编译和虚拟机这些东西都藏身于python35.dll文件中。有感于今天编写一个多进程脚本时,一个简单资源分配都算了好久,决定每周争取一篇聊聊计算机相关话题,一篇会写写一些简单算法实现。

    38530

    身份验证是如何验证我们身份?

    当初遇见他,我并不知道他是离线。我以为谷歌身份验证肯定是绑定谷歌账号。后来找了半天,原来他只是个离线软件。相信有很多同学和我一样想法:离线身份验证如何能使我们登录在线场景? ​...身份验证是谷歌产品。之前版本有开源仓库 https://github.com/google/google-authenticator。...有info 有secret信息 $oneCode = $ga->getCode($secret); //通过秘钥生成验证码(就是身份验证实时显示数字) echo "Checking Code '$...= 2*30sec clock tolerance if ($checkResult) { echo 'OK'; } else { echo 'FAILED'; } 至此,我们已经有了身份验证大致工作流程...并且是不可逆。如果确实感兴趣。可以更加深一步查看相关函数方法。如果不感兴趣的话,就只需要知道 :身份验证是基于时间和秘钥,就可以了。

    4.1K10

    【Rust 基础篇】Rust Newtype模式:类型安全包装

    在Rust中,Newtype模式是一种常见编程模式,用于创建类型安全包装。Newtype模式通过定义新结构体包装包装现有的类型,从而在不引入运行时开销情况下提供额外类型安全性。...Newtype模式是一种常见编程模式,用于创建类型安全包装。在Rust中,Newtype模式通过定义新结构体包装包装现有的类型,从而在不引入运行时开销情况下提供额外类型安全性。...// Newtype模式示例:定义新结构体包装 struct MyInt(i32); 在上述例子中,我们使用Newtype模式定义了一个新结构体包装MyInt,用于包装现有的类型i32。...但要注意,Newtype包装方法调用可能会稍微增加一点性能开销。 4.2 Newtype包装和类型转换 Newtype包装在编译时提供了更强类型安全性,但也意味着需要进行一些类型转换操作。...在使用Newtype包装时,需要注意类型转换情况。 结论 RustNewtype模式允许通过定义新结构体包装包装现有类型,增强类型安全性并增加语义表达力。

    37240

    详解python解释安装以及简单py

    1、首先要有一个python解释,如果不知道在哪里下载的话,大家可以去我博客里下载,免费。安装很简单,我已经安装过了就不给大家演示了。 2、下图是安装完成之后 ?...3、接下来是配置系统环境变量,大家可以看我上一篇博客是如何配置系统环境变量,配置完成之后如下图,注:我这里只有一个环境变量,如果你是多个,就直接用;号隔开直接在后面追加就好了。 ?...4、打开cmd命令行窗口,直接输入python,如下图就表示解释启动成功 ? 5、提示符中输入以下语句,按回车键查看运行效果: ?...6、也可以通过命令执行python脚本,以下是我在脚本中写代码。 ? 7、通过命令执行python脚本。 ?

    44920
    领券